    Laughing W/ Laraaji & Arji

    Laughing W/ Laraaji & Arji

    Jessi & Yam share a special message from their listeners, and the two of them have a conversation with legendary ambient/new-age artist Laraaji & his partner Arji Oceananda about the medicinal qualities of laughter, the portable and lightweight aspects of the human voice, why singing in the grocery store might be a good idea, and what it means (and sounds like) to live a higher-vibrational life.  Laraaji covers the Beatles, and Yam shares a song with Jessi inspired by meeting his personal hero called Hello Forever.

    LEVEZA | Laraaji

    LEVEZA | Laraaji

    I'm very grateful to have LARAAJI on my next show LEVEZA with an exclusive deep listening session for the radio.

    Laraaji is synonymous with ambient music, meditation and cosmic energy - his Laughter workshops, deep listening performances and yoga tours have become a program highlight at some of the worlds finest arts institutions, festivals and clubs. Awakened to mysticism in the 70's, Laraaji bought a second hand zither and began busking around Manhattan and Brooklyn - he was playing in Washington Square Park when Brian Eno heard him, resulting in Laraaji recording the third release of Eno's seminal "Ambient" series. Forty years and almost fifty albums later, Laraaji is at the forefront of deep listening and ambient music.

    Black Mirror, The Chi, Forgotten Films of 2017 with Dave Karger, Pop Culture Resolutions – IP 106

    Black Mirror, The Chi, Forgotten Films of 2017 with Dave Karger, Pop Culture Resolutions – IP 106

    Did you resolve to put more time and energy into staying on top of the best pop culture stories of the week? Lucky for you, The Pop Insiders are here to help you keep that resolution with our brand new episode!

    First, we give our spoiler free reviews of the new Lena Waithe Showtime drama - The Chi (please feel free to listen and then correct our pronunciation of the title of this show) and the first episode of the new season of Black Mirror.

    Then we speak with IMDb special correspondent and frequent Today Show awards commentator - Dave Karger - about the movies of 2017 that may not be front-runners for the big awards, but are definitely worthy of your attention. From Detroit to Wonderstruck to Downsizing, Dave will tell you why you should give these flicks a second - or maybe first chance.

    We also share our pop culture resolutions for the new year and hold each other accountable for how successful we were in keeping our 2017 resolutions.

    And the Big Sell returns - Sean recommends (wait for it) a new new age song (nope that isn't a typo) to start Amita's year off on an optimistic and blissful note.
